What is a High Cube Shipping Container?
High cube shipping containers resemble basic shipping containers however are 1 foot taller. Typically, this added height makes them an outstanding option for carrying bulky goods or taking full advantage of storage space. While standard shipping containers generally determine 8 feet high, high cube containers procedure 9.5 feet high.
Specs of High Cube Containers
To better comprehend the dimensions and capabilities of high cube shipping containers, let's look at a comparison table.
Container TypeLength (ft)Width (ft)Height (feet)Interior Volume (cubic feet)Payload Capacity (lbs)Standard 20' Container2088.51,16952,910High Cube 20' Container2089.51,30852,910Requirement 40' Container4088.52,38761,000High Cube 40' Container4089.52,69461,000
Table 1: Specifications of Standard vs. High Cube Shipping Containers

What are the primary differences in between basic and high cube shipping containers?
The main distinction in between basic and high cube containers is height. High cube containers are an additional foot taller than basic containers, supplying more interior volume.
2. Can high cube containers be stacked?
Yes, high cube containers can be stacked similar to basic containers. They are designed for stacking throughout shipping and storage, which optimizes space utilization.
3. What kinds of goods appropriate for high cube containers?
High cube containers are ideal for transferring large items, such as furniture, equipment, or big amounts of light-weight items like textiles. They are likewise suitable for items that need vertical storage.
4. Are high cube containers weather-resistant?
Yes, high cube containers are made from heavy-duty steel with protective finishes to stand up to harsh weather. Nevertheless, proper ventilation is vital to avoid moisture accumulation inside when used for long-lasting storage.
